Output e70331c8a8716ce80a50cdf79d69a6db15afe94c519f8cd2fcf82c80264d260c:3

value
3668560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3add31e1b9b017781d5358cc8fb39e019370cea0 OP_EQUAL
address
374G6ZHv1XpvAHFfXs8YU6qgbfpPPXAQcM
transaction
e70331c8a8716ce80a50cdf79d69a6db15afe94c519f8cd2fcf82c80264d260c
spent
true